Output 3c6194fa4011421be711e3ab8ed427a0a2b5a566571a148a337c5c1ef899d926:0

value
386199
script pubkey
OP_0 OP_PUSHBYTES_20 b58810f6774968aab60ed5e9bdd2253513f6d6ed
address
bc1qkkyppanhf9524dsw6h5mm539x5fld4hdgzzcc9
transaction
3c6194fa4011421be711e3ab8ed427a0a2b5a566571a148a337c5c1ef899d926
confirmations
31845
spent
true